dc.description.abstractAn experimental program was carried out to investigate the flexural behavior of Carbon Fibre Reinforced Polymer (CFRP) strengthened reinforced concrete curved beams using the Near Surface Mounted technique (NSM). Seven curved beams were tested, and three of them were taken as control beams without having CFRP. Four-point bending test was used to evaluate the performance in out of plane bending. CFRP strengthened beams showed a significant increase in the ultimate load by almost 23% and 10% for the retrofitted beams with 2000 mm and 4000 mm curvature beam respectively compared to the control beams.en_US
